What's Happening?
Mariah Carey headlined the opening ceremony of the 2026 Winter Olympics in Milan, delivering a memorable performance at the San Siro stadium. Carey performed a medley of the classic ballad 'Volare (Nel Blu Dipinto Di Blu)' and her own song 'Nothing Is
Impossible' from her recent album. The singer expressed her excitement about participating in such a significant global event, emphasizing the honor of being part of a moment that unites the world. Carey's performance was complemented by a custom Roberto Cavalli dress, designed to reflect Italian glamour and the spirit of the Olympics. The opening ceremony also featured performances by Andrea Bocelli and Charlize Theron.
